Tirupati:
Tirumala Tirupati Devasthanams (TTD) inaugurated a first aid centre at the 7th mile intersection along the Alipiri-Tirumala pedestrian route on Sunday. This new medical centre was jointly inaugurated by TTD chairman B R Naidu, EO Anil Kumar Singhal, and additional EO Ch Venkaiah Chowdary. According to TTD Additional EO, about 20,000-30,000 devotees trek up to Tirumala through the Alipiri and Srivari Mettu pedestrian routes every day. While the TTD already set up a first aid centre along the Srivari Mettu pedestrian route in the past, a similar first aid centre for the convenience of the devotees has now been set up along the Alipiri route.
TTD authorities appealed to the devotees who fall sick while trekking up to Tirumala to approach the first aid centre for necessary medical treatment and then proceed further with their trek.
